When we have, say, an ECDSA key confirmed by fingerprint and RSA key to
be confirmed, we have EC-based KEX, so the KEX-based prevention of
using SHA1
(https://github.com/openssh/openssh-portable/blob/7a7c69d8b4022b1e5c0afb169c416af8ce70f3e8/serverloop.c#L725-L730)
will not work and SHA1 will be used for the proof of posession of the
RSA key.
